MELBOURNE WATER SUPPLY.

A tiny cascade of crystal ice-cold water breaking from a bower of fern trees on the northern side of the Dividing Range is the first and furthest of the thousand mountain springs that supply nearly 400,000 of the people of the colony with one of the requisites of life. The silver thread widens, and appropriately becomes the Silver Creek, as other equally idyllic fountains emerge from silent and hidden gullies, and would have still further grown to be a part, first of the King Parrot Creek, next the Goulburn, and finally of the Murray, but just here the engineer and artisan throw a weir of solid masonry across the stream, and the water turns from the course it has fol-lowed for so many centuries to stream through an aqueduct of glistening white granite over cascades natural and artificial, and through reservoirs until Melbourne opens its iron mouth and engulphs it. The Yan Yean reservoir is the key of the whole system, and appropriately gives it a title which, like very many of the names originating with the aborigines, has been per-verted for the sake of greater euphony.

"Yean Yan "in the language of one of the local tribes meant a haunt of water birds, for the site of the present reservoir was originally a reedy lagoon covering an area of some 800 acres, to which water fowl of all kinds flocked in the breeding season. Swans built their rushy pyramidal nests in thousands amongst the reeds, and as the supply of eggs and young was far in excess of what the local tribes could consume, the aboriginal laws as to the ownership of game and food of all kinds were here, as in the Bunya Bunya country of Queensland, con-siderably relaxed. So it became a gathering place of the blacks us well as the birds. Though the former have entirely disappeared, the latter still cling to their old customs. The present season----a rainy one-has ex-tended the reservoir beyond its former limits, and the water, creeping over the swampy ground on the eastern side, presents something of its original appearance, Amongst the rushes both swans and ducks have nested in large numbers, and the young broods are just now paddling about among the rushes with their parents. To the fact of this being a popular meeting place of the tribes is attributed the presence of a strange building on one of the hills near the north-eastern shore of the reservoir. It is a peculiar mixture of the mediaeval in design, and the modern in the materials used for con-struction, the latter being almost entirely "wattle and dab." With miniature towers at each angle, a flat roof, and parapet, gained by a spiral staircase from the ground floor, it presents all the appearance of a place built for defence against the blacks, and is known as "Bear's Castle." Those who have been

familiar with the locality for over 40 years describe it as presenting very much the same appearance then as now, and its history is somewhat vague. The architect was probably a reader of Mayne Read and Fenimore Cooper, and more familiar with the blockhouse of the Indian frontier fictions than the customs of the Australian abori-gine. Had the blacks' method of fighting made it at all possible that they should attempt to storm such a stronghold, a few men with firearms would, no doubt, have given a very good account of their ammunition, but the native warriors were much more likely to attempt a surprise, if they desired it, when the owner was abroad and unsus-pecting. Cleverly as they might throw their long fighting spears, these could have little effect against opponents ensconced in Bear's Castle. The castle was erected by the late Mr. Bear, who, it is said, left directions in his will for the keeping of the building in re-pair by his heirs.

It took some considerable time to evict the gangs of splitters who had posses-sion of the range when the scheme for bringing in the waters of the Wallaby and Silver Creeks was first devised. They have laid their hands heavily upon the heights that overlook Whittlesea valley, and it being naturally desirable that the condensation of moisture on these high lands should be promoted as widely as possible, all the areas devastated by axe and fire have been re-planted with bluegums and mountain ash. It is not an infra-quent occurrence to find a peak in the range entirely bare, while a sister point is

thickly clothed in green . The explanation is that the timber on the one spur is gnarled messmate, with a crooked, unkind grain, which makes it not worth cutting, while over the open area once stretched a belt of splendid mountain ash, which, on account of its commercial value, soon went down before the splitter.

Melbourne, in its infancy, was fairly served by the Plenty River, but the rich lands along its course were not long left vacant, and soon it became clear that a stream subject to sewage contamination was out of harmony with the modern ideal both in character and quantity. Mr Davidson, who has surveyed nearly the whole of this wild country, and is as familiar with every range and track as with the streets and squares of Melbourne, looked to the northern watershed for future supplies. Years before, someone had suggested the possibility of tapping the King Parrot Creek, and carrying its waters through a tunnel from the northern to the southern side of the range. This scheme would have entailed some seven miles of mountain boring, the greater part probably through solid rock, and was always regarded as chimerical. It, however, suggested, no doubt, the plans which have since been carried into effect, and was in so far beneficial. Nature, generally an opponent to be overcome, in all great engineering undertakings, had been so far considerate in this case as to have left a rift in the range, which made it possible to bring in, if not the King Parrot Creek, at least some of its important feeders, these being tapped, of course, at a point just sufficiently above the altitude of this natural break to give the necessary fall, by gravitation, through an open aqueduct. The proposal was dis-cussed, and its feasibility placed beyond doubt, but yet it remained for some years in that stage of suspense to which all large state undertakings are subject, vis, being "under consideration." The Watts scheme, which presented bigger pos-sibilities, was also being considered, and but for a sudden and unexpected develop-ment the names of the Wallaby and Silver Creek would have been much less familiar than they are at present. It was all at once discovered than Melbourne was rapidly out-growing its means of water supply, and that long before, the Watts River could be brought in a water famine would be precipitated. The danger presented was so alarming that instant

action was necessary, and it was decided that the Wallaby waters should be at once secured, and then those of the Silver Creek. The history of these works constructed to meet an emergency need not be repeated, but beginning at the furthest limit, and taking the work as it stands com-pleted, some figures as to cost and capacity will help to give a better knowledge of the system. Commencing with a mile and a quarter of minor channels for the concen-tration of the springs that feed the Silver Creek, the waters, to the extent of five millions of gallons per day, are diverted from the natural bed, and carried over eight miles of aqueduct to fall into a beautiful pool formed by the weir on the Wallaby Creek. Issuing on the opposite side of the pool the waters increased to 12 millions of gal-lons daily run over another 5½ miles of glistening aqueduct and tumble down a pre-cipitous hillside - where a number of arti-

ficial cascades have been formed - into the natural bed of Jack's Creek. Another four miles along the stream bed-bed - a most interesting four miles it ¡s-and the waters reach the Toorourong reservoir, which covers an area of 13 acres, and holds 50 millions of gallons. Thence they emerge once more in a larger granite aqueduct, and run for 4¾ miles to the old basalt channel of the Plenty, and into the Yan Yean reservoir, a total distance of 7½ miles from Toorourong, and-with the exception of the short run down the natural bed of Jack's Creek-over masonry for

the whole journey. Indeed, the exception is barely worth mentioning, for the fall of the land from the cascades to the foothills is so rapid that the added volume of water thrown into Jack's Creek has cut a bed for itself well down into the limestone A bridle track has been cut along the range from its foot to the cascade, and this is by far the most picturesque stage in a journey to the sources of the Yan Yean. It might appro-priately be called the White Water Valley, for the stream is it turmoil of white foam throughout. Half-way down it leaps over a higher precipice than usual, and this has been named the Minnie Falls. Seen within a framing of splendid tree ferns, it is a charm-ing bit of natural landscape, to which, in the added volume of water, only artificial aid is given.

A word now about the older works. The Yan Yean reservoir to-day extends over about 1,390 acres of land, and will hold 6,400 millions of gallons. The outlet is over a stone race, and here Mr. Wilson, the resident inspector, measures out to Melbourne its supply. He counts his millions of gallons by quarter inches in depth in the water rush-ing over the race, but, before the management is explained, some further information as to work is necessary. From Yan Yean the water flows in a bluestone aqueduct to the Pipe Head reservoir, a picturesque pool of

some three million gallons capacity, which serves the purpose of concentrating the water before it for the first time disappears into underground pipes. Next it issues in the Preston reservoir, where there is room for 16 millions of gallons, and for the last time disappears into the four mains-one recently added-which carry it to Melbourne, and dis-charge it into every little artery of that immense system of circulation. There is daily communication between Preston and Yan Yean, Every morning at 9 o'clock, and in very hot weather during the afternoon also, Mr. Wilson is informed by wire as to the depth of the water in the Preston tank, and on that intelligence he regulates the output. If Preston in falling slowly, he refrains from tinkering the supply, but lets it sink to a cer-tain point, and then adds to the output not alone the actual loss, but the daily average loss also, so that the levels may remain as nearly as possible normal. But, say that Preston is 19ft. to-day mid and to-morrow he finds that it has fallen to 14ft. This is evidence of an abnormal con-sumption in Melbourne, so up go the Yan Yean flood gates, and as much water as the aqueduct can carry surges along until the strain is once more eased. The consumption fluctuates constantly, and but for careful management exhaustion would be as fre-quent as overflow in the Preston reservoir. The aqueduct from Yan Yean to Preston will carry 34 millions of gallons per diem, the Melbourne pipes 44 millions, the increase

being intended to secure a certain amount of extra storage within the mains. From the

weir on the Silvery Creek to, say, Brighton or Gipay Village, the most remote of the suburbs which have regular supplies, the water is carried a distance of 60 miles.

The system, as it stands, is about the best commercial concern in Australia, and Mr Fitrgibbon, who is so anxious to have it under municipal control, is not the only one cognisant of the fact. Its entire cost was £2,300,000, and the whole of it has been paid back in water rates with the exception of about £100,000, which will be cleared off during the present financial year. The more rapid the expenditure the more rapid, proportionately has been the return The revenue from water is increasing at the rate of about £16,000 a year, and the great difficulty has been to keep pace with suburban extensions. Critics say tha t all this should have been foreseen, but if the office of the department had been gifted with such a capacity for looking into the future they would no doubt have at once abandoned such a business as the distribu-tion of water, have retired from the service, and become millionaires as the leading spirits in a land syndicate. The cost of what may be called the modem works, and which include the construction of nearly 20 miles of aqueduct, two weirs, and a reser-voir, as well as the purchase of land, was in

round figures £190,000.

The system of distribution after the five

mains have carried their 44,000,000gal. daily across the Merri Creek is shown in the plan which appears above. The black lines indi-

cate the mains only, and generally follow the line of streets and main roads , but the pipes which carry water to every square of build-ings, not to mention separate tenements, would make a network so intricate as to con-fuse rather than assist a comprehension of

the scheme.

The figures which in each case accompany the name of a street or road indicate the diameter of the pipe passing along that par-ticular thoroughfare. Small circular reser-voirs are shown at Caulfield, Kew, and Coburg, the object of which is to store during the slack hours a supply which will help to compensate the heavy drain during busier periods of the day. During a period of ex-cessive heat the Water Supply department can, by a system of stops and valves, cut off a portion of the supply from any place where the supply is more than sufficient, and force it on to where there is a scarcity. The last water famine in the suburbs was attributable to the fact that, although there was suffi-cient water in all the reservoirs to keep the Preston mains full, the drain at the earlier off-take pipes was so great that there was little hope of getting anything like sufficient pressure either at the remote suburbs or on high levels. With the fifth main recently added the engineer of water supply is, how-ever, able to say that even during the hottest weather he will be able to keep

all pipes wet. It is thought that the

building " boom" has now so far slackened that the department will in future be able to keep pace with legitimate extension.

In the larger works the substitution of wrought for cast iron pipes now considerably facilitates as well as cheapens the work of the department. One great source of trouble is the want of knowledge on the part of fire-men in dealing properly with plugs and it is accepted almost as a matter of course that after every fire of any magnitude a burst pipe in the locality of the fire will require to be

repaired

The main shown upon the lower right-hand corner of the map as following the Point Nepean road is now in course of construction. In connection with the smaller diagram, show-ing what are called the by-pass mains, it may be explained that the letters A and B on the pipes entering the Preston reservoir from Yan Yean indicate points at which the supply may be shut off when the reservoir is full, and the water thus diverted directly into the Melbourne mains.
